Keep reading Beautiful flowers on a Knockout rose, but the spring flush is starting to discolor.

After the first stunning flush of flower, the plant begins to fade. This is because the first blossoms have actually been cross-pollinated and the plant is hectic with its inherited job of making seeds. This appears as dead blossoms and The seed pods develop and the flowers drop. Right here's what is going on.

In order to mislead the plant that it needs to make even more flowers, the seed sheaths must be gotten rid of. This is called" All severe flower growers learn about deadheading and I talked with Judy regarding her Ko roses a few days ago regarding it. Judy said that removing each spent bloom took a great deal of time and trouble.

My sensation on the deadheading work on the roses (and the method I do it on the work) is to combine the task of I begin by looking down into the plant to separate the stems which have actually mainly invested blooms. Look inside the plant to isolate the stems with invested blossoms In performing my job, I am attempting to promote new development and even more blossoms.

If I reach inside the plant and cut the stem (straight over a new leaf node) I can not only obtain the plant deadheaded in much less time but likewise create the stem to branch out and make even a lot more blossoms than in the past. You may review some of the concepts of trimming in this short article on The concept is the same.

Here is what I cut. deadheading and pruning the Ko climbed at the very same time. After this cutting, the old stem will branch out and develop brand-new development which will create much more flowers and will, once again, look like this: New growth on the Ko increased The procedure is truly instead straightforward and you probably won't ruin.

The Knock senseless rose was reproduced to be durable and disease resistant. It was established and evaluated in Wisconsin by Costs Radler the previous supervisor of Boerner Botanical Gardens. I have one of the original plants and never ever provide wintertime protection. I have to confess took a pounding this previous winter months yet new growth appeared in June and it expanded and prospered all season.

In either case let the plants stand for winter season to raise wintertime strength. If you feel the need Recommended Site to mulch, wait until after the ground ices up. You can cover the base of the plant with evergreen boughs, straw, marsh hay, or garden compost. In springtime eliminate any kind of winter season injury. Each springtime remove any type of dead tips or stems.

Trimming Knock Out Roses is not absolutely needed, yet in our experience they take advantage of it and it's very simple! Here are some guidelines for pruning Knock Out Roses properly ... How To Trim Knock Senseless Roses, Late Winter Months Trimming, Knock Out Roses can be pruned greatly in late winter season or very early spring.

This tough trimming can be done while plants are still inactive in later winter or simply when you begin to see new fallen view leaves begin to emerge. At this time, reduced the bush back to about 12-18" over the ground. When trimming, make your cut just above an outward-facing leaf bud.

A 5 leaflet leaf collection often tends to be where the walking cane is thick enough to sustain the following lengthy stem flower that will certainly grow from it. For shaping objectives, you can additionally reduce roaming branches that are ruining the form of the bush. Damaged branches can and ought to be eliminated at any time of year.

By Sharon Driskill, Somervell Area Master Gardener Among the most preferred roses in North America is the Knock senseless rose. The Knock Out increased shrub was created by Costs Radler. It is one of the most preferred roses in North America. They are simple to expand and do not require much treatment.

Their flower cycle is about every five to 6 weeks. These roses are called "self-cleaning" roses, so there is no real requirement to deadhead them. They are warmth tolerant so they do well in a lot of sunny and warm places. When it concerns expanding Knock Out roses, they can quite much be listed as plant them and forget them roses.

If no pruning is done to change their height and/or size, the Knock Out roses can reach 3 to 4 feet broad and 3 to 4 feet tall. In some locations, a very early springtime trimming 12 to 18 inches over the ground functions well, while in locations with more difficult wintertimes click here to read they might be trimmed to around 3 inches over the ground to remove the dieback of the canes.
